Columbus Police Department, Georgia
End of Watch Saturday, February 5, 1921
Add to My HeroesWilliam G. Pate
Officer Pate was shot and killed on 13th Avenue, between 19th and 20th Streets, while working a plainclothes detail following a recent string of burglaries in the area. A suspect was identified but never charged. Officer Pate's murder remains unsolved.
